Hopi katsina figures ( Hopi language: tithu or katsintithu ), also known as kachina dolls, are figures carved, typically from cottonwood root, by Hopi people to instruct young girls and new brides about katsinas or katsinam, the immortal beings that bring rain, control other aspects of the natural world and society, and act . In a way they're like statues of saints. Aholi is a beautiful kachina in his multicolored cloak and tall blue helmet but is of less importance than the very plain Eototo. Butterfly Maiden Kachina Doll: The Palhik Mana, or Butterfly Maiden, is one of the most popular kachinas, which is beautifully dressed and usually not masked. They first arrive on the Hopi mesas in February and return to their spiritual homes in July. Carved kachina figures, also known as kachina dolls, are representations of these spirits and can have a sacred or an educational purpose. Clothing that is painted on or created from fabric. On the back of his cloak is a likeness of Muyingwa, one of the Germ Gods responsible for the germination of the seeds.
